About this episode

This episode explores lesser-known stories in London, Ontario’s history, including the city's origins and the first Black chapel.

This podcast highlights lesser-known stories in London, Ontario’s history. In this episode, we explore London’s origins, the story of the city’s first Black chapel, and the history behind Irish immigration to the area. Through these conversations, we highlight the importance of history and why these stories should continue to be shared. To bring these stories to life, we visited three different locations across the city and spoke with local historians and experts.
